The MIC5235-3.3YM5-TR belongs to the category of voltage regulators.
It is used to regulate voltage in electronic circuits and devices.
The MIC5235-3.3YM5-TR comes in a small outline SOT-23 package.
This voltage regulator is essential for maintaining stable voltage levels in various electronic applications.
The MIC5235-3.3YM5-TR is typically packaged in reels with a quantity of 3000 units per reel.
The MIC5235-3.3YM5-TR has three pins: 1. Input (VIN) 2. Ground (GND) 3. Output (VOUT)
The MIC5235-3.3YM5-TR works by comparing the output voltage to a reference voltage and adjusting the pass transistor to maintain a stable output voltage despite changes in input voltage and load conditions.
This voltage regulator is commonly used in battery-powered devices, portable electronics, and low-power microcontroller systems where stable voltage supply is crucial for proper operation.
Some alternative models to the MIC5235-3.3YM5-TR include the LM1117, MCP1702, and AP2112. These alternatives offer similar voltage regulation capabilities with varying specifications and package options.
